Reba McEntire is strong in her faith, but she says she learned most of her values by example from watching her family, and not just from growing up inside the Bible Belt. The spunky redhead even sparked some lively debate last year after declaring her belief in reincarnation, but she's quick to credit her faith in God for getting her through some tough times."People said I can't be a Christian if I believe in reincarnation," Reba tells the Toronto Star. "But I always felt God loves us so much He'd want to recycle us and not just throw us away. Maybe I'm part Buddhist, part Christian, but you don't have to categorize or label me. Just say that I'm a true believer in a higher power. My faith has always been very important to me. I don't know how I would have survived in this world without it."
